The brief

The agreement makes Witherspoon the highest‑paid cornerback in NFL history, surpassing previous benchmarks for the position. Coverage of the deal appears across several major outlets. USA Today headlined the move as the Seahawks making Witherspoon the highest‑paid CB in NFL history. Sports.yahoo.com emphasized the “record‑breaking $132 million contract” and highlighted Witherspoon’s status as a “beloved 3× Pro Bowl” player.

The Seattle Times echoed the extension narrative, while NFL.com and ESPN both cited sources confirming the four‑year, $132 million terms. The consistent language across these sources underscores the significance attributed to the financial magnitude and Witherspoon’s accolades. Witherspoon’s three Pro Bowl selections position him among the league’s elite defensive backs, a fact repeatedly noted in the reporting. The contract’s size establishes a new ceiling for cornerback compensation, a trend that follows recent escalations in salaries for premium defensive talent.

By locking in a four‑year, $132 million deal, the Seahawks align with a broader pattern of teams securing top‑tier players through long‑term, high‑value agreements, a context that helps explain why the extension is framed as historic. Quick answers

What are the length and total value of Devon Witherspoon’s new contract?

The extension runs for four years and is valued at $132 million.

Which media outlets reported the Witherspoon deal?

USA Today, sports.yahoo.com, The Seattle Times, NFL.com and ESPN all reported the agreement.

How does the contract rank historically for the cornerback position?

The deal makes Witherspoon the highest‑paid cornerback in NFL history.
